Working Principles

The LCMXO2280C-5M132C operates based on the principles of programmable logic. It consists of an array of configurable logic blocks (CLBs) interconnected through programmable routing resources. The CLBs contain look-up tables (LUTs), flip-flops, and other components that can be configured to implement desired logic functions. The device is programmed using HDLs, which define the behavior of the logic circuitry.
